CeLeen, an operating group of Command Holdings, is seeking a Senior Intelligence Analyst to support a contract with the Pentagon Force Protection Agency.
Responsibilities May Include, But Are Not Limited To- Identifying, assessing, and referring threats, threat trends and tactics or situational awareness of local disruptions to Pentagon Force Protection Agency (PFPA) missions.
- Fulfilling Requests For Information (RFI's) from the shared inbox by reading and confirming RFIs, develop a research plan for the RFI, complete the research and submit an information product of your research according to how the requestor needs the RFI.
- Researching, writing, publishing, and briefing informational products that highlight new threat trends, tactics, or other relevant information that affects PFPA mission and responsibilities.
- Attending staff meetings, working groups, and conferences for the purpose of understanding and learning new threat trends, to provide pre-approved information from PFPA that the group may not have and to provide PFPA leaders advice.
- Providing advisement and assistance in developing new or modified work methods, teamwork, innovative approaches, and alternative uses of new or available data sources.
- Provide analytical support to PFPA to identify threats such as terrorism, criminal, and foreign intelligence directed toward PFPA missions and responsibilities.
- Coordinating local, state, and federal information from Law Enforcement (LE) and Intelligence Community (IC) information for production of threat intelligence products and disseminate products to relevant PFPA members and external partners.
- Attending and briefing threat information and actionable intelligence to decision makers within PFPA and external partners.
- Establishing long term intelligence services and capabilities for the Threat Intelligence Center.
- Coordinating, creating, submitting, and presenting summary reports of relevant threat information from LE and Intelligence Community information.
